There are SO many different designs of Minnie Ears out there, and don’t get us wrong, we love that! But there’s one thing they almost all have in common that doesn’t seem to get much better — they HURT!

Oswald the Lucky Rabbit Ear Headband

It’s true! We can’t tell you how many times we’ve walked into the parks with a pair of ears on that totally match our outfit, or that we just bought and we want to show off, but within a few hours, we’ve got a headache from them. Sometimes, this headache can’t be solved by painkillers as long as you still have the ears on, because they’ll continue to squeeze and put pressure on your head. There’s really no way to solve this, except for keeping them on and dealing with the pain (which can severely make your day less fun, and no one wants that — the ears were expensive, yes, but you know what was more expensive? Your park ticket.), or taking them off and not getting to show them off.
